Project Skill Delivery

LoopX can ship a canonical skill without adding it to every user's global agent configuration. A release-owned skill opts into project delivery by adding:

skills/<skill-id>/.loopx-skill-scope

with the exact content:

project

The global installer keeps that source in the versioned LoopX release and skips global skill installation. A connected project can then install one or more host-native managed copies:

loopx project-skill install \
  --project . \
  --skill <skill-id> \
  --surface codex \
  --surface claude-code \
  --surface opencode \
  --execute

Surface Map

Surface Project target
codex .agents/skills/<skill-id>/
claude-code .claude/skills/<skill-id>/
opencode .opencode/skills/<skill-id>/

These locations follow the host discovery contracts documented by Codex, Claude Code, and OpenCode.

Lifecycle

All mutations are preview-first:

loopx project-skill status \
  --project . \
  --skill <skill-id> \
  --surface codex

loopx project-skill install \
  --project . \
  --skill <skill-id> \
  --surface codex

loopx project-skill uninstall \
  --project . \
  --skill <skill-id> \
  --surface codex

Add --execute only after reviewing the plan. The managed marker records the release version, source digest, skill id, and host surface. Install and uninstall fail closed for unmanaged targets, local modifications, symlink escapes, missing project connection, or failed digest readback.

Multi-surface installation stages every target before replacement and restores earlier targets if a later replacement fails. The implementation copies the whole skill directory instead of linking SKILL.md, so supporting scripts, references, and host metadata remain complete.

Authority Boundary

Project skill delivery controls discoverability, not domain authority. A project-local skill cannot create a LoopX goal, todo, write scope, operator gate, material-store authority, or external permission. Each consumer capability still declares its own activation and mutation contract.

loopx-material is the first consumer: the skill can be visible in a project while Material Lifecycle remains default-off for every goal that has not explicitly activated it.
